Founded in 1833 by Antoine LeCoultre in Switzerland’s Vallée de Joux, Jaeger-LeCoultre revolutionized watchmaking by uniting every stage of production under one roof. A visionary inventor, LeCoultre pioneered precision tools to craft exceptionally accurate calibres. Today, the Manufacture remains one of the few to design, develop, and produce its timepieces entirely in-house.


The Jaeger-LeCoultre Master Ultra Thin Moon Enamel is a refined limited-edition timepiece that showcases the brand’s expertise in craftsmanship and design. Featuring a rich blue guilloché enamel dial, the watch highlights an elegant moon phase complication and a date display within a subdial at six o’clock. Housed in a slim 39 mm white gold case, it is powered by the in-house calibre 925, which is made up of 245 components and beats at a frequency of 28800 vph with a 70-hour power reserve offering a blend of precision, sophistication, and wearability. Limited to 100 pieces, this dress watch exemplifies Jaeger-LeCoultre’s dedication to artistry and technical excellence.
